Class Experience

In this one-time 45 minute class students will learn how to draw a fun cartoon turkey using basic shapes such as circles, ovals, rectangles, triangles and more. We will kick off the class reading "How to Catch a Turkey" by Andy Elkerton and then jump into the step-by-step drawing. 

We will discuss the different colors of turkeys but students are encouraged to choose whichever colors they would like for their drawing. We will also learn some fun facts about turkeys as we draw. 

Supplies needed for this class: 
* Sheets of blank paper or a drawing pad 
* Pencil 
* Eraser 
* Colored pencils, crayons or markers in your choice of colors
